Ways to review words (try to choose words to review that your child needs support with):
-Rainbow write them! Write the words three times! Each time in a different color.
-Fill a baking sheet with salt, flour, etc. have your child trace their words in the baking sheet
-Have them write the words in chalk outside (on a nice day!)
-Use magnetic letters or stamps to spell the words for fun

Readers Workshop- please log onto Raz Kids and read a book and take the quiz.
Please try to remember to use your super reader powers as you read.
-
Picture power
-
Pointer Power
-
Sound out power
-
Sight (snap) word power
-
Read on power (If you get to an unfamiliar word, read the rest of the sentence, and go back to the word you are unsure of to see if you can figure it out)
-
Don’t Give up (perseverance power)
